The LogTag TREX-8 is a temperature recorder of an approximate size similar to a credit card.
Only this datalogger allows for the connection of an external sensor, with choice between 1.5m or 3m, made of teflon or stainless steel, with gold point of contact, ideal for use with foods.
Works at a temperature between -40°C ~ +99°C. The sensor is very precise (from ±0.5°C to±0.8°C depending on the temperature) and provides a quick reaction during changes in temperature.
The LogTag TREX-8 includes 2 LEDs to indicate the state of the datalogger (LED OK and Alarm LED) and a button to start recording. The registry recording can be started with the button or programmed with a delay.
Allows the recording of up to 8032 samples and the frequency of sampling can be configured from 30 seconds up.
To configure and download the necessary data an interface, which is not included, must be used. It is a base which is attached to the datalogger and is connected by USB to the PC.
The software allows visualisation of graphic data for analysis. It also allows the export of data to be used with other tools.
It is compatible with the Window operating systems and complies to the FDA 21 CFR Part 11.
